Comments/Problems:
Insert netinst CD cd boots without problem runs through inital country
setup questions detects cd then cannnot load installer modules. I
return to the inital menu where i peform a CD integrity check at which
point I am told that it is not a valid Debain CD. I have been trying
the installer since the first release and the same problem has occured
each time.
